Mitch Cousino levels sand before placing bricks in sidewalks under construction along Huron Street in downtown Toledo near the new Mud Hens stadium.

Mild weather has enabled work on the project to continue unimpeded. The high temperature yesterday was 65, six degrees lower than the record for Nov. 16.

The unseasonably warm weather is expected to continue through Sunday, but forecasters for the National Weather Service say a cold front will arrive Monday with cooler temperatures and a chance of snow showers.
